All about undefined

Interested in learning more?

  • 009 39263 30

    172173 0894242909 112 752374523 236664800

    See more
  • 840 76829340 9911

    4303412 04679 30

    See more
  • 08270406 035671674

    18892477 12923 309298541

    See more